Soil and air temperature and humidity are environmental factors that affect plant growth. Therefore, monitoring these conditions is important in the agricultural sector. This study aims to design a data logger to measure soil and air temperature and humidity. Data were collected using a data logger system that works automatically in various environmental conditions. This study took place from December 2024 to March 2025, at the Agricultural Energy Sub-Laboratory, Department of Agricultural Technology, Faculty of Agriculture, Sriwijaya University. Measurements were made by comparing the sensor results with standard tools, namely soil moisture meters and data loggers. The test results showed that the DS18B20 sensor had an accuracy of 97% compared to standard tools, Capacitive Moisture Soil V2.0 had an accuracy of 96.26%, while the BME280 had an accuracy of 97.61% for air temperature and had an accuracy of 96.35%. In addition, soil and air temperature and humidity showed fluctuating patterns that could affect plant physiological processes. Based on the research results, this sensor can be used as a real-time agricultural environmental monitoring tool with a fairly good level of accuracy. Keywords: Tool Accuracy, Arduino UNO R3, data logger, Soil and Air Temperature, Soil and Air Humidity
